IQinVision, market leader in high-performance HD megapixel IP cameras, recently announced that the company will preview its new Milestone Arcus™ on-camera VMS functionality during the ASIS tradeshow in Atlanta, GA.

This simple, seamless solution offers unlimited scalability and replaces the traditional server and storage devices with a single IQeye on-camera VMS designed for small system installations. The Milestone Arcus solution is ideal for simple stand-alone installations, remote recording applications, or for systems that require minimum network bandwidth utilisation.

Milestone Arcus is easy to install: initial deployment is complete within minutes after connecting user’s IQeye cameras and requires little or no maintenance; easy to use:  the intuitive, all-in-one user interface allows users to log in to operate the solution from a web browser, users can view live video, search and export video without any additional software; and easy to maintain:  no software installation or maintenance required on client PCs, updates are rolled out easily through firmware updates.
